Understanding the WCN3615 IC
First things first, what exactly is the WCN3615 IC? Well, it's a highly integrated, multi-radio System-on-Chip (SoC) designed by Qualcomm Atheros. It's primarily used for Wi-Fi, Bluetooth, and FM radio functionalities. This means it handles a lot of the wireless communication tasks in your devices. Think of it as the central hub for all things wireless! It's super versatile and designed to be power-efficient, making it ideal for mobile devices and other battery-powered gadgets.
Key Features and Specifications
The WCN3615 IC boasts a range of impressive features. It supports the 802.11a/b/g/n Wi-Fi standards, meaning it's compatible with a wide range of Wi-Fi networks. It also includes Bluetooth 4.0, which allows for fast and reliable connections with other Bluetooth devices. And, of course, it has an integrated FM radio receiver. Some key specs to keep in mind include:
- Wi-Fi Standards: 802.11a/b/g/n
- Bluetooth: 4.0
- FM Radio: Integrated receiver
- Power Consumption: Designed for low power usage
- Interfaces: Typically uses interfaces like SDIO and UART

Wi-Fi Compatibility
Because the WCN3615 IC supports the 802.11a/b/g/n standards, it's compatible with most Wi-Fi networks you'll encounter. Whether you're connecting to a home router, a public Wi-Fi hotspot, or a Wi-Fi network at work, this chip should have no problem establishing a connection. Make sure your router is broadcasting on a supported frequency band (2.4 GHz or 5 GHz) and that the security settings are compatible with your device. It is generally backward compatible, so even older Wi-Fi routers should work just fine, making it a highly adaptable component.

Troubleshooting Common Compatibility Issues
Sometimes, even with all these great features, you might run into a few hiccups. No worries, though – let's cover some common issues and how to fix them.
Wi-Fi Connection Problems
If you're having trouble connecting to Wi-Fi, there are a few things to check. First, make sure your Wi-Fi is enabled on your device. Then, verify that you've entered the correct password for your network. Check your router's settings to ensure your device is allowed to connect. Sometimes, rebooting your device and your router can resolve connectivity problems. Also, make sure that your device is within range of the Wi-Fi signal, as being too far away can cause connection issues. If problems persist, try forgetting the network on your device and then re-entering the password to re-establish the connection.
Bluetooth Pairing Issues
Bluetooth pairing can be a bit finicky sometimes. If you can't pair a Bluetooth device, start by making sure Bluetooth is enabled on both your device and the accessory. Ensure the device you're trying to connect is in pairing mode (usually indicated by a blinking light). Try restarting both devices. Make sure your device is not already connected to too many other Bluetooth devices. Finally, check for any interference from other electronic devices, as these can sometimes disrupt the Bluetooth signal. If you've tried all these steps and are still having trouble, consult the user manual for your specific devices for more detailed troubleshooting steps.
FM Radio Reception Problems
Poor FM radio reception is often due to a weak signal or interference. Make sure your device has a working antenna (usually the headphone cable). Try moving to a different location, as being indoors or in an area with a lot of obstructions can weaken the signal. If you're using headphones, make sure they are plugged in correctly. If the signal is weak in your area, you might need to try different listening positions or consider using an external antenna for improved reception. Sometimes, simply moving to a different spot in the room or a different room altogether can make a huge difference in the signal strength.
